In this Certificate in Ocean Conservation Principles, you'll explore various roles in the UK's ocean conservation sector, ranging from marine biologists to policy analysts. Let's dive into these roles, their salary ranges, and skill demands. 1. **Marine Biologist**: With a 40% share in ocean conservation jobs, marine biologists study the behaviors, diseases, and genetics of marine life. Their average salary ranges from £20,000 to £50,000. 2. **Oceanographer**: Making up 25% of the industry, oceanographers examine the physical and chemical properties of oceans. They earn an average of £25,000 to £60,000 per year. 3. **Policy Analyst**: Representing 15% of the sector, policy analysts create and implement conservation policies, with salaries between £25,000 and £80,000. 4. **Conservation Scientist**: With a 10% share, conservation scientists manage the protection, restoration, and sustainable use of natural environments. Their salaries range from £20,000 to £50,000. 5. **Education & Outreach**: Completing the list, education and outreach professionals (10%) work to inform the public about ocean conservation. They earn between £15,000 and £40,000. This 3D pie chart offers a visual representation of the UK's ocean conservation job market trends, emphasizing the importance of each role in the sector.
